AI Summary

This bill requires long-term care facilities, such as nursing homes and assisted living facilities, to meet with residents and their families at least once a year to review the resident's emergency contact information on file with the facility. Additionally, the bill requires the facilities to offer residents the opportunity to update their emergency contact information at least twice a year. The bill also clarifies that the facilities can share information about a resident with individuals who are not listed as emergency contacts, as long as it is consistent with federal and state privacy laws.
